The Lanham Trademark Act title 15, chapter 22 of the United States Code is a piece of legislation that contains the federal statutes of trademark law in the United States . The Act prohibits a number of activities, including trademark infringement , trademark dilution , and false advertising . History Named for Representative Fritz G. Lanham of Texas , the Act was passed on July 5, 1946, and signed into law by President Harry Truman , taking effect one year from its enactment , on July 6 , 1947. Edwin Moultrie Lanham was born in Weatherford, Texas on October 11, 1904, in the north central part of Texas where his family settled in the 1868. His family included his grandfather S. W. T. Lanham , the former Governor of Texas. His father Edwin Moultrie Lanham, Sr., died when Lanham was four, and his mother, Elizabeth Stephens Lanham, remarried soon after and joined her husband in New York City. Lanham began writing in Paris, France in 1928, and his writing career spanned many decades, and more than twenty novels. Lanham married a model Irene Stillman in 1928 in Clinton, CT, and had one daughter Evelyn in 1935. His only books to have received significant levels of literary praise were both written in the 1930s. The Wind Blew West is his most critically acclaimed work, and contains a fictional retelling of the Warren Wagon Train Raid of 1871 and the subsequent trial of the Native American defendants. In 1940, Lanham received one of the Guggenheim Fellowships , which funded his novel Thunder in the Earth . After World War 2, Lanham ceased writing literary fiction, and his entire writing career focused thereafter on mystery writing. These detective stories, moreover, remain popular among genre fiction readers. In addition, three of his detective stories were turned into Hollywood films entitled The Senator Was Indiscreet If I m Lucky 1946 and It Shouldn t Happen to a Dog 1942. Richard A. Lanham born 1936 is probably most widely known for his textbooks on revising prose to improve style and clarify thought. He is also a notable scholar of the history of rhetoric who has published notable books on the subject. Richard A. Lanham was born in 1936 and educated at Sidwell Friends School and Yale University A.B., M.A., Ph.D. . He is Professor Emeritus at the University of California, Los Angeles, and president of Rhetorica, Inc., a consulting firm. Lanham is a recognized expert in prose stylistics and Classical and Renaissance rhetoric. His Handlist of Rhetorical Terms 2nd ed., 1991 is the standard reference in the field, and he recently revised his Analyzing Prose 2nd ed., 2003 , a benchmark work in stylistic analysis. Some other works are The Motives of Eloquence Literary Rhetoric in the Renaissance , Style An Anti Textbook , Literacy and the Survival of Humanism , and The Electronic Word Democracy, Technology, and the Arts 1995 . His Revising Prose and Revising Business Prose now in revision remain popular. Lanham known as Buck was born September 14, 1902 in Washington D. C. He graduated from West Point in 1924. He included among his many military adventures the command of the U.S. 22d Infantry Regiment in Normandy in July 1944, and was the first American officer to lead a break through the Siegfried Line on September 14, 1944. He led a breakout in the Battle of the Bulge after surviving a bloody ordeal in the Battle of Hurtgen Forest . It was in the Normandy battles that Lanham and Ernest Hemingway first met. Hemingway was doing battlefield stories for the American audience for Collier s and sought assignment with Lanham s regiment. Hemingway described Lanham as, cquote The finest and bravest and most intelligent military commander I have known. Colonel Buck Lanham ... story writer and poet. orphan date May 2008 Clifton Joseph Joe Lanham , Jr. born December 28, 1981, in Bedford, Ohio , is a former American radio personality . Broadcasting career Joe Lanham began his broadcasting career in 1998, when he joined the administrative staff of WSTB WTSB FM as it first community service director, becoming the staff s youngest member at the age of 16. One year later, he was promoted to director of traffic and continuity. He also filled in for the station s weather director, Bob Long, when Long was away on vacation or remote broadcasts. He left the station in the summer of 2000. Lanham was also an on air personality during his two and a half years at WSTB. He was known for his trademark playing of the song The End The Doors song The End by The Doors at the end of each of his on air shifts. He briefly co hosted the popular Joe and Strong Show on Monday nights, and also served as co host for the station s Friday all request show. After leaving WSTB, Lanham founded an internet radio station known as J ROCK the J standing for Joe, his name in the spring of 2002. The station s format consisted mainly of a mix between classic rock classic and modern rock , with heavily rotated artists including Led Zeppelin , Pink Floyd , Rush band Rush , Stone Temple Pilots , Rage Against the Machine , and Tool band Tool . ref http web.archive.org web 20021012101030 j rock.20m.com custom2.html J ROCK Top 15 artists, Aug. 15, 2001 ref As the station s only staff member, the work load proved to be too much for him to handle by himself. The station was on the air briefly following its founding, but only lasted a couple of months. Frederick Garland Fritz Lanham January 3, 1880 July 31, 1965 ref name HoTO cite web url http www.tshaonline.org handbook online articles LL fla33.html title Handbook of Texas Online accessdate 2009 03 05 ref was a member of the United States House of Representatives from the state of Texas . A Democratic Party United States Democrat , Lanham was the son of S. W. T. Lanham Samuel Willis Tucker Lanham , a governor of Texas and himself a member of Congress. After graduating from the University of Texas at Austin with a Bachelor of Arts B.A. in 1900, ref name HoTO he was admitted to the bar association bar in 1909. He was elected to Congress in 1919 and served until 1947. A proponent of strong trademark protection, the LanhamAct is named after him. Henderson Lovelace Lanham September 14, 1888 November 10, 1957 was an United States American politician and lawyer . Lanham was born in Rome, Georgia Rome , Georgia U.S. state Georgia . He attended the University of Georgia in Athens, Georgia Athens where he was a member of the Sigma Chi Fraternity, and graduated with an Bachelor of Arts in 1910 and Bachelor of Law degree with honors in 1911. He also graduated from the Harvard Graduate School of Arts and Sciences in 1912. Lanham served as the chairman of the board of education in Rome in 1918 and 1919. In 1929, he was elected to the Georgia House of Representatives and served until 1933. Lanham was re elected to that body in 1937 and served until 1940. He was elected as the solicitor general of Rome judicial circuit from 1941 to 1946. Later in 1946 Lanham was elected as a Democrat to the United States House of Representatives U.S. House of Representatives and served until he was killed in an automobile accident in 1957 in Rome. He was buried in Myrtle Hill Cemetery in that same city. A staunch segregationist, in 1956, Lanham signed Southern Manifesto The Southern Manifesto.
